    Joshua Smith Photo

    Joshua Smith

    Founder & Creative Director, Who’s That?

    Detroit

    Joshua A. Smith is the Founder & Creative Director of Who’s That? Over the last decade, he has witnessed Detroit’s creative and economic resurgence as a visionary observer and advocate for local businesses, partnering with founders, artisans and cultural organizations, to elevate their work and bring focus to their stories. In the course of studying and building a retail design practice in the Motor City, he has touched brands large and small, from Shinola and Bedrock to Paramita Sound and Detroit Denim Co.

    Joshua believes that good design begins with human interactions and the sharing of new experiences. As such, he works collaboratively with clients, stakeholders, communities, and other creatives. Joshua also regularly contributes his talents to nonprofit, civic and cultural organizations across the city including Design Core, Hatch Detroit, the New Economy Initiative, and the AIGA.

    Outside of work, his passions include, cars & automobility, cities & place-making, futurism, hospitality in the sharing economy, smart home appliances, and collective consciousness.
